How families and households are made up across the area.
Much larger households than most similar areas define North Boyanup, where the typical home holds 2.8 people. This is a family-focused community with very few people living on their own compared to the rest of the state.

Only 10.5% of people live alone, which is far below the Western Australian figure of 25.4%. Because so few live alone, the typical home here is slightly larger than the national average.

In North Boyanup, the largest group is 2 people at 45%, followed by 3 people (21%) and 4 people (20%).
Family types and one-parent families.
Couples with children make up over half of all families at 53%. Single-parent families are less common here at 7.8%, a figure well below the national average of 14.1%.
